Meet the Rhodesian Ridgeback

The Rhodesian Ridgeback is a strong and athletic breed that originated in southern Africa. They were originally bred to hunt lions, which is why they are known for their bravery and fearless nature. The most distinctive feature of the Rhodesian Ridgeback is the ridge of hair along their back that grows in the opposite direction of the rest of their coat. This breed is known for being loyal, independent, and protective of their family.

Introducing the Australian Retriever

The Australian Retriever is a cross between the Australian Shepherd and the Golden Retriever. This breed is known for being intelligent, friendly, and affectionate. They are highly trainable and make excellent family pets. Australian Retrievers are also known for their stunning appearance, with a long, flowing coat and expressive eyes.
